The Unflinching Gaze of V.S. Naipaul; Seconds Thoughts on His Work of Three Decades

From: The Washington Post | Date: April 12, 1989| Author: | Copyright information

V.S. Naipaul has never been one to mince words or embrace a gooey sentiment. "Never give a person a second chance," he has said. "If someone lets you down once, he'll do it again." And: "I'm not concerned in preserving the backward races. I find them very boring." And: "It is well that Indians are unable to look at their country directly, for the distress they would see would drive them mad."

Over the last three decades, Naipaul's caustic reports on the "half-made" developing societies have earned him the rage of left-wing intellectuals-and a wide audience for his 11 books of fiction and ...
